Message type: E = Error
Message class: DA - Dictionary: Compare, distribution, timer, instantiation
Message number: 174
Message text: Line &1: Error in called subschema &2

- Line &1: Error in called subschema &2 ?The SAP error message DA174, which states "Line &1: Error in called subschema &2," typically occurs in the context of payroll processing within the SAP Human Capital Management (HCM) module. This error indicates that there is an issue with a specific subschema that is being called during the payroll calculation process.
Cause:
- Incorrect Configuration: The subschema referenced in the error may not be configured correctly. This could be due to missing or incorrect entries in the payroll schema or subschema.
- Missing or Incorrect Data: The error may arise if the necessary data for the payroll calculation is missing or incorrect. This could include employee master data, infotypes, or other relevant data.
- Custom Modifications: If there are custom modifications or enhancements in the payroll schema, they may not be functioning as intended, leading to errors.
- Version Issues: Sometimes, the error can occur due to version mismatches between the payroll schema and the underlying data or configuration.
Solution:
- Check Configuration: Review the configuration of the payroll schema and the specific subschema mentioned in the error message. Ensure that all necessary entries are present and correctly configured.
- Review Data: Check the employee master data and infotypes to ensure that all required information is complete and accurate. Look for any missing or incorrect entries that could affect payroll processing.
- Debugging: If you have access to debugging tools, you can analyze the payroll run to identify the exact point of failure. This may help you pinpoint the issue within the subschema.
- Consult Documentation: Refer to SAP documentation or notes related to the specific subschema to understand its requirements and any known issues.
- Testing: If changes are made to the configuration or data, perform a test payroll run to verify that the issue has been resolved.
- Contact SAP Support: If the issue persists and you cannot identify the cause, consider reaching out to SAP support for assistance. They may provide insights or patches related to the error.
